Handover for new folks on the Garrivale Arena turnstile counter. The service tallies gate entries every 30 seconds and pushes totals to the ops dashboard. If counts stall, restart the collector first; the gates buffer locally for ten minutes, so nothing is lost. Dray owns the hardware side. Everything the collector needs at startup is set in the following values.

config for haweg-bagag:
[kasath]
host = kasath.qirvancorp.internal
user = kasath_svc
database = kasath_prod

// Tax-rate lookup cache TTL for the Verabill checkout service.
// Rates are fetched from the Norfell rates service and cached
// per region code. Security note: cached entries are keyed by
// region only — no customer data is stored, so this cache is
// safe to share across tenants. Lowering the TTL below 300s
// caused rate-limit lockouts during the Klev region rollout,
// verified against the build noted below.

trace token, kahog-tajeg: htk6_97d963

Subject: Lobby turnstile upgrade this week

Hello all, and welcome to our new starters. The lobby turnstiles at Arlevane House are being replaced Tuesday through Thursday, so the barriers will be out of service. During the works, everyone enters through the gate beside the front desk. Your permanent badge will work again once the new readers go live Friday. Until then, the gate is keypad-controlled, and you'll need the temporary code, which is below.

door code, yagap-bahof: bdg-O-05

Ticket VLT-2291: Vault locked — validator plugin keys inaccessible

The Corvane signing vault auto-locked after three failed attempts, blocking release of the Mistvale validator plugin SDK. Contractor: do not retry the old credentials. Plugin manifests still build; only signing is blocked. Unlock via the recovery console on the build host, then rotate the session. The console accepts the passphrase below.

vault phrase of kawep-tahog = ulaix-briath